What is this?
The trek starts in Imlil, traversing lush landscapes to reach the pilgrimage site of Sidi Chamarouch. Here we will have a picnic lunch, before continuing up the mule trail to the Toubkal refuge.
What makes this unique?
While Sidi Chamarouch’s shrine remains a spiritual site closed to non-Muslims, its market and cafes welcome all, providing a blend of spiritual and local commerce.
